Frotec RO-3012-300 is a Domestic Reverse Osmosis Membrane that will provide 300 US Gallons per day, 47 Litres per hour optimum output. It is an Ultra Low Pressure Domestic Reverse Osmosis Membrane that can be used in most types of RO filters.

The Frotec membrane has a 50Psi output, which is the same pressure as most homes. This means you can expect to achieve a much higher RO water output than most other membranes that need a pressure of 60-70Psi, making them less suitable to the average home.

Other Reverse Osmosis membranes are difficult to remove from their housing, with pliers or grips need to be struggled with to break the seal. The Frotec membrane has a hexagonal thread on the end, so you simply insert an Allen key, turn, and remove the membrane. On top of this, the American Membrane technology means a 20% increased water output at lower water pressures.

Operating conditions:

  • Elements contain preservative solution, therefore the permeate from the first hour of operation should be discarded, to flush the protective solution in the elements.
  • Keep elements moist at all times after initial wetting

Elements should be immersed in a protective solution during storage, shipping or system shutdowns to prevent biological growth and frost damage.

If the operating conditions are not followed appropriately , we can not honor the warranty of the element as you will be unnecessarily reducing the life of the filter.

Technical Information

  • Membrane Type: Polyamide Thin-Film Composite
  • Maximum Operating Pressure: 300psi (21bar)
  • Maximum Feed Rate: 2.0gpm (7.6 lpm)
  • Minimum Concentrate Flow Rate: 4 × permeate flow
  • pH Range - Continuous Operation: 2-11pH Range,
  • Short-Term 1Cleaning(30min)b: 1-12
  • Maximum Operating Temperature: 113F (45)
  • Maximum Feed water Turbidity: 1 NTU
  • Maximum Feed Silt Density Index.: 5
  • Free Chlorine Tolerance: <0.1ppm
  • Maximum temperature for continuous operation above pH 10 is 95 (35).
  • b Refer to Cleaning Guidelines of ANDE-AMF.
  • c Under certain conditions, the presence of free chlorine and other oxidizing agents will cause premature membrane failure. Since oxidation damage is not covered under warranty, we recommend removing residual free chlorine by pretreatment prior to membrane exposure.
  • Permeate flow and salt rejection based on the following test conditions:
  • 250ppm softened tap water, 77 F(25 C),
  • PH=8, and 15% recovery and the specified pressure at 50psi.
  • Permeate flow rates for individual elements many vary +/-20%.
